Output 03acf901be6525932b7f41638fd42611837d0fa53a2fb5773172e9bb3380098c:0

value
3586736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7275f62dceccb873dea1c1ffac58caa4ba0bce44 OP_EQUAL
address
3C8EGXjEHqJAXUdT7wyAMyivnPLRik3yVk
transaction
03acf901be6525932b7f41638fd42611837d0fa53a2fb5773172e9bb3380098c
confirmations
361369
spent
true